【日期格式有哪几种】在日常生活中,我们经常需要处理日期信息,比如填写表格、编写程序、安排日程等。不同的系统和应用场景中,日期的表示方式也各不相同。了解常见的日期格式有助于提高工作效率,避免因格式错误而引发的问题。
以下是几种常见的日期格式总结,涵盖国际标准、地区习惯以及编程语言中的常见用法。
一、常见日期格式分类
1. 国际标准格式(ISO 8601)
- 格式:`YYYY-MM-DD`
- 示例:2025-04-05
- 特点:无歧义,适用于全球通用场景。
2. 美国格式(MM/DD/YYYY)
- 格式:`MM/DD/YYYY`
- 示例:04/05/2025
- 特点:在美国广泛使用,但可能与其他地区混淆。
3. 欧洲格式(DD/MM/YYYY)
- 格式:`DD/MM/YYYY`
- 示例:05/04/2025
- 特点:在欧洲国家普遍使用,与美国格式容易混淆。
4. 中文格式(YYYY年MM月DD日)
- 格式:`YYYY年MM月DD日`
- 示例:2025年04月05日
- 特点:适合中文环境,表达清晰。
5. 短日期格式(YYYY-MM-DD)
- 格式:`YYYY-MM-DD`(与国际标准相同)
- 示例:2025-04-05
- 特点:简洁明了,常用于数据库和文件命名。
6. 长日期格式(YYYY年MM月DD日 星期X)
- 格式:`YYYY年MM月DD日 星期X`
- 示例:2025年04月05日 星期六
- 特点:用于正式文档或日历显示。
7. 时间戳格式(Unix 时间戳)
- 格式:`数字`(表示自1970年1月1日以来的秒数)
- 示例:1712345678
- 特点:常用于编程和系统日志中。
8. SQL 日期格式
- 格式:`'YYYY-MM-DD'` 或 `'YYYY/MM/DD'`
- 示例:'2025-04-05'
- 特点:用于数据库查询和存储。
二、常见日期格式对比表
| 格式名称 | 格式示例 | 使用地区/场景 | 优点 | 缺点 |
| ISO 8601 | 2025-04-05 | 全球通用 | 无歧义,标准化 | 需要理解格式 |
| 美国格式 | 04/05/2025 | 美国 | 简洁,常用 | 容易与欧洲格式混淆 |
| 欧洲格式 | 05/04/2025 | 欧洲国家 | 简洁,符合本地习惯 | 可能引起误解 |
| 中文格式 | 2025年04月05日 | 中国、东亚地区 | 表达清晰,易于阅读 | 不利于程序处理 |
| 短日期格式 | 2025-04-05 | 数据库、文件命名 | 简洁,便于存储 | 缺乏时间信息 |
| 长日期格式 | 2025年04月05日 星期六 | 日历、正式文档 | 信息完整,表达明确 | 字符较多,不适合数据存储 |
| Unix 时间戳 | 1712345678 | 编程、系统日志 | 精确,便于计算 | 无法直接阅读 |
| SQL 日期格式 | '2025-04-05' | 数据库操作 | 标准化,兼容性强 | 需要引号包裹 |
三、如何选择合适的日期格式?
根据使用场景选择合适的日期格式非常重要:
- 国际化项目:推荐使用 ISO 8601 格式。
- 国内应用:可采用中文格式或 DD/MM/YYYY。
- 数据库存储:建议使用 `YYYY-MM-DD`。
- 程序开发:可结合 Unix 时间戳或 SQL 格式进行处理。
总之,掌握多种日期格式并合理使用,是提升效率和减少错误的关键。希望本文对您有所帮助。


